#1 The Chuck Wagon

It’s not sexy, it’s not even that cool, but it’s MINE. There is no feeling like making and racing your own kart, and it’s 100% yours. Look out for this kart online, you’ll both know who to aim your weapon at. If it passes you up, you’ll know who just smoked you!

#2 Mini-Me

Some racers will make their favorite characters, some will think of some completely original creations of their own. But if you’re like me, you will put yourself in the game so when you showboat, you can say, “THAT’S ME!”

#3 Bringing the Hurt (and avoiding it too!)

We’ve covered this subject in past blog posts, but the weapons are a BLAST (see what I did there?). While I love raining down the pain in a well-timed Bolt Storm or dropping a well-placed mine right in front of a tailgater, there is a great feeling hitting my shields just at the right moment to avoid an attack or dodging a nasty missile like this.

#4 Attitude Adjustment

What I love about ModNation Racers is that as soon as you get cocky, the game will remind you of your mistake. It doesn’t matter how good you think you are, there is always someone better, or who has a weapon ready to trigger. As soon as I got online I learned the hard way. Ouch! No matter how much time I’ve spent with the game, there are some great racers out there.

#5 Trading Paint

While weapons are fun, the art of the sideswipe is a beautiful thing. Lining up next to a racer, tapping your right analog stick just at the right time, and smacking your competion into railing (…or off a very high cliff) is pure bliss.

#6 Fire From My Tires

Drifting is huge source of joy in this game, but when you drift long enough, your tires ignite and light up the road. Best Back to the Future tribute ever.
